Russian Glide Bombs Hit 2 Ukrainian Temporary Military Hubs in Donetsk People’s Republic

 / Go to the mediabankThe FAB-500 bombs are seen in the Russian special military operation zone. File photo / Go to the mediabank

MOSCOW (Sputnik) — The Russian Aerospace Forces hit two points of temporary deployment of the Ukrainian armed forces in the Donetsk People’s Republic (DPR) using FAB-3000 and FAB-1500 gliding bombs, the Russian Defense Ministry said on Saturday. During the reconnaissance, the Russian forces discovered the temporary deployment points of Ukrainian units in the Donetsk People’s Republic. «The identified targets were attacked by Russian air force crews using FAB-3000 and FAB-1500 aerial bombs with a universal planning and correction module (UMPK),» the ministry said in a statement.
